“Trawler?” Well, unlike many full-displacement vessels more frequently associated with the trawler tag, Beneteau’s Swift Trawler 34 has a semi-displacement running surface that allows her a top end in excess of 20 knots from her single 425 hp Cummins at WOT. But you can pull the throttle back to 2,000 rpm and cruise in diesel-sipping comfort with a range of over 300 miles. |
| The 34 provides exceptional room, comfort, and economy for a cruising couple, and with standard bow and optional stern thrusters, it singlehands easily in tight spaces. |

| We all know the bittersweet sound of our bilge pumps. Bitter, because we know water has infiltrated our hull. Sweet, because we know it’s getting pumped back where it belongs. But when we hear the sound too often, we know there’s a potentially dangerous problem. |
| A sailor heading south for the winter stopped at our Charleston facility with a chronic leak. A New Jersey service stop failed to identify and fix the problem, and it seemed to be getting worse. The batteries were certainly getting a workout! |
| A check at the dock revealed no obvious leakage from the stuffing box or any of the through-hull fittings. Our tech found moisture near one of the through hulls, however. Taking the boat out for a spin revealed a leak at the fitting as the boat approached 6 knots. We hauled the boat, removed the fitting, cleaned it, replaced it and resealed it. Three weeks later we received a postcard from Key West from the happy owner. |
| Face it, there’s no shortage of things that can go wrong on a boat. But proper inspection, regular maintenance, and thorough commissioning can prevent many problems during your boating season. Through hulls are obviously a potential problem source deserving attention on at least an annual basis. They certainly take a high priority in our yard! |

| St. Barts Yacht Deliveries (SBYD) have been delivering Beneteaus for charter companies since the month my daughter, Sarah, was born almost 19 years ago. |
| In that time we have taken well over 1,000 trips, most of them to and from the Caribbean. Our longest deliveries have been from Charleston, SC to Tahiti in the South Pacific. All sailed on their own bottom (well, sometimes motored – if the wind don’t blow we still gotta go!), delivered on time, and fully shipshape. |
| The safety record of Beneteau Sailboats is exceptional, and our blue water experience bears this out. |
